Output 4f80cc712adc91db70105d63e60a352be53f9bdedc48572d0a66c4dc2f66ec1f:0

value
5443071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e8349b1717af90fc95f6e26e47e076e94f2ae96 OP_EQUAL
address
35vxHQexTCtuiP1mVfq5XniYWyQHTX3Twa
transaction
4f80cc712adc91db70105d63e60a352be53f9bdedc48572d0a66c4dc2f66ec1f
spent
true